How far is Parkersburg from Salisbury, North Carolina?

The distance from Parkersburg to Salisbury, North Carolina is 255.5 miles (411.2 km) as the crow flies. Salisbury, North Carolina is located SSE of Parkersburg. By car, the driving distance is approximately 319.4 miles, taking about 6h 26min. A direct flight would take roughly 1h 1min. Both are located in United States — Parkersburg in West Virginia and Salisbury, North Carolina in North Carolina.
